Art of the Day: "Looking deep, 2016" by Leonid Plekhanov

“The theme of woman with water means something special, reflecting inner controversial nature of the human, with its deepness of emotional flows, beauty and constant self-discovery. 'Looking deep' has many layers of perception - emotional, artistic and thematic. It is made using original dynamic palette knife technique, which adds additional space of perception by making contrast to the subject of the painting.”
